Beschreibung

The pleasant route leaves the spa town of Bad Ragaz and climbs past the Freudenberg castle ruins with views of the Rhine and Seez valleys to the Vilterserberg. After a short descent over hiking trails and paved roads, it passes through Mels along the hillside following the Seez river and climbs the short ascent to Sargans Castle. The castle embodies two hundred years of county history and more than three centuries of varied Vogt rule. The count's castle houses one of Europe’s most significant local history museums and is a witness to the homeland history of the Sarganserland region. Additionally, the castle offers wonderful views over the surrounding villages and mountain scenery. After a short descent to the entrance of the Gonzen iron ore mine, where the Romans already mined iron ore, the route crosses the Sarganser Au. Along the Rhine dam, it continues to Giessenpark Bad Ragaz and back to the starting point at the Tamina Therme Bad Ragaz.

Geheimtipp

The Marien Grotto outside Mels was modeled after the world-famous Lourdes Grotto and invites for quiet reflection.

Anfahrt

Öffentliche Verkehrsmittel

Bad Ragaz is reachable by public transport in about an hour from St. Gallen and Zurich. The train station is a 15-minute walk from the Tamina Therme. The Postbus stops directly in front of the Tamina Therme.

Anreise Information

The Tamina Therme Bad Ragaz is only an hour’s drive from St. Gallen and Zurich and 30 minutes from Feldkirch. Use the Maienfeld motorway exit and follow the signs or Google Maps: Tamina Therme on Google Maps .

Parken

Public parking is available in the parking garage of the Tamina Therme (paid).
